Validating the ICF core set for cerebral palsy using a national disability sample in Taiwan
Hua-Fang Liao1,2, Ai-Wen Hwang2,3,4, Veronica Schiariti5
1School and Graduate Institute of Physical Therapy, College of Medicine, National Taiwan University, Taipei, Taiwan.
This study validated International Classification of Functioning, Disability, and Health (ICF) core sets for children with cerebral palsy (CP) in Taiwan. The ICF core sets cover most functional data, with some suggested additions for improved assessment.

Background:
- Cerebral palsy (CP) is a leading cause of childhood physical disability.
- The International Classification of Functioning, Disability, and Health (ICF) core sets aid in comprehensive CP assessment and service delivery.
- Validating ICF core sets ensures their relevance and applicability in specific populations and healthcare systems.
Purpose of the Study:
- To validate the activities and participation (d) codes within two age-specific, brief ICF core sets for school-aged children with CP.
- To assess the coverage and predictive value of these ICF core sets using a national dataset from Taiwan.
- To identify potential additions to the ICF core sets for improved assessment in the Taiwanese context.
Main Methods:
- Analysis of a national dataset of 546 students with CP aged 6-17.9 years in Taiwan.
- Linking items from the child version of the Functioning Scale of the Disability Evaluation System (FUNDES) to ICF d-codes.
- Calculating restriction rates of linked d-codes and using Random Forest regression to identify important predictors of school participation frequency.
Main Results:
- The two brief ICF core sets demonstrated substantial content validity, covering the majority of the Taiwanese dataset.
- Matched d-codes showed high restriction rates (80%) and were largely significant predictors of school participation.
- One important ICF code, d740 (formal relationships), was identified as relevant but not included in the existing core sets.
Conclusions:
- The validated ICF core sets effectively capture essential functional information for children with CP as measured by the child FUNDES.
- The study recommends considering additional ICF codes, such as d740, for inclusion in revised Taiwanese versions of the core sets.
- The findings support the clinical application of specific ICF codes for assessing school participation in children with CP.
